C. Removing the Last Original

Sensor PCB (U504)

1) Remove the original tray. (See 1.
"Removing the Original Tray" under I.
"Basic Construction.")
2) Remove the two mounting screws [2], and
detach the original tray cover [1].
[2]
[1]
Figure 3-403
3) Disconnect the connector [5].
4) Remove the two mounting screws [4], and
detach the last original sensor PCB [3].

D. Original Width Detecting
Volume (VR)
1. Removing the Original Width
Detecting Volume
1) Remove the original tray. (See 1.
"Removing the Original Tray" under I.
"Basic Construction.")
2) Remove the cover of the original tray. (See
C. "Removing the Last Original Sensor
PCB (U504)."
3) Disconnect the connector [3].
4) Remove the screw [5], and remove the
grounding wire [4].
5) Remove the two mounting screws [2], and
detach the original width detecting volume
PCB [1].
